How long after my mastectomy can I undergo Breast Cancer Reconstruction?
Dr. Vennemeyer and your breast surgeon will work together to develop treatment options to fit your long term goals. Then, based on your cancer treatment plan, Dr. Vennemeyer will discuss all of your reconstruction options and answer your questions. After you have all the information to make an informed decision, your ultimate reconstruction plan will be up to you. 
In some cases, immediate breast cancer reconstruction is a good option. If chemotherapy or radiation is required after your mastectomy, you will likely need to wait until these treatments are completed before undergoing your breast reconstruction surgery.

What are my options for Breast Cancer Reconstruction?

Depending on your goals, anatomy and personal preferences there are several breast reconstruction methods available. Some women prefer breast reconstruction with breast implants. Others prefer to use their own natural tissue. In the latter case, tissue from the patient's abdomen or back can be used to rebuild their breast.
